About The Tilted Farmer

The Tilted Farmer offers a warm and inviting atmosphere with impeccable service and delicious food. The staff accommodates large groups seamlessly, making it perfect for special occasions or gatherings. The Bavarian Pretzel Sticks and Wisconsin Cheese Curds are recommended appetizers. The Gyro and Chicken Philly are standout menu items, with generous portions. The restaurant's popularity is evident, with a full parking lot and packed tables, indicating its success despite being a new establishment. The Mother's Day Buffet was incredible, with hot, well-prepared, and delicious food, including prime rib and Marsala Chicken. The restaurant also provides a great atmosphere, with live music by Charles Geil and his ghost band. Overall, The Tilted Farmer is a promising dining option with great potential for a return visit.
